BlockBeats News, August 11th, according to LookIntoChain monitoring, the Infini attacker sold 1,771 ETH (worth $7.44 million) today at an average price of $4,202.

On February 24th, the attacker exploited a vulnerability to steal $49.5 million from Infini, buying 17,696 ETH at a price of $2,798. Taking advantage of the ETH price increase, on July 17th, they sold 1,770 ETH (worth $5.88 million) at $3,321 and transferred 4,501 ETH (worth $15.03 million) using Tornado Cash.
